Detailed explanation-1: -Vapour is the gaseous form of a substance that’s normally a liquid or solid at room temperature, while gas refers to any substance in a gaseous state at room temperature.

Detailed explanation-2: -Vapor refers to a gas phase at a temperature where the same substance can also exist in the liquid or solid state, below the critical temperature of the substance. (For example, water has a critical temperature of 374 °C (647 K), which is the highest temperature at which liquid water can exist.)

Detailed explanation-3: -A vapor refers to a gas-phase material that that normally exists as a liquid or solid under a given set of conditions. As long as the temperature is below a certain point (the critical temperature; this varies for each substance), the vapor can be condensed into a liquid or solid with the application of pressure.
